How do I change the flashcard review mode?
Open Advanced settings and choose Random, Leitner, or SM-2 flashcard behavior.

How do I practice vocabulary by level?
Use level filters in Browse, Collections, Examples, or Games to focus on a CEFR range.
-
How do I combine filters for focused practice?
Apply several filter chips, such as collection plus word type plus success, to create a very specific study set.
-
How do I understand the green and red success markers?
Success markers show whether a word has been answered correctly or incorrectly in games.

How do I use predefined Chat prompts?
Use Chat about from a lookup menu and choose a prompt such as Grammar, Translation, Meaning, Context, or Practice.
-
What should I do when a translation is unclear?
Compare Translator output with Browse details, Examples, and Chat explanations before saving or using the translation.
